Micro Homestead Hacks: Irrigation For Massive Yields
Start cultivating your own/very own micro homestead with some brilliant DIY irrigation methods/systems. Not only will this support you in conserving precious water, but it'll also maximize/optimize your harvest/yields. There are a ton/bunch/heap of unique ways to implement an irrigation network tailored to your specific/individual needs and space.
- Investigate a simple gravity-fed system using rain barrels or collected water for your/a low-maintenance solution.
- Drip irrigation/Soaker hoses/Micro sprinklers are fantastic for delivering water directly to the roots, minimizing evaporation and enhancing your plants' progress.
- Get crafty/DIY it/Build something amazing by constructing a wick irrigation system using fabric or rope to slowly transport water from a reservoir to your cultivation zones.
With a little thought, you can create an efficient and sustainable irrigation system/solution that will help your micro homestead grow.
Build a Budget-Friendly Homemade Watering System
Want to sustain your garden thriving without costing a fortune? A homemade watering system can be just the ticket. You don't need fancy tools to get the job completed. With a little creativity and some basic supplies, you can construct an efficient and inexpensive watering system that meets your garden's needs.
Start by assessing your garden's size and water needs. Then, procure items like rubber pipes, connectors, a controller, and pipelines. You can even reuse old containers like buckets to create your own watering tanks.
Set up the pipes and connectors to channel water to your plants. A simple siphon system is effective for conserving water. Consider using a switch to automate the watering process, saving time and energy.
Remember to check your watering system regularly to confirm that it's functioning properly and adjust as needed. With a little planning and effort, you can develop a budget-friendly homemade watering system that will sustain your garden for years to come.

From Rain to Roots: Crafting Your Own Micro Homestead Watering System
Harnessing the power of rainwater and creating a DIY watering system for your micro homestead is a rewarding endeavor. You can reap the benefits of sustainable living while ensuring the plant in your garden gets the hydration it needs to flourish. It's a journey that involves careful planning, resourceful solutions, and a touch of gardening enthusiasm. A well-designed system will significantly reduce your reliance on municipal water sources, saving you money and conserving valuable resources.
- Starting with, consider your micro homestead's layout and the plants you wish to grow. Determine the size of your system based on your needs.
- Then, explore different rainwater harvesting options, such as rain barrels or a cistern. These structures collect rainwater from rooftops and downspouts.
- And then, design your watering system to efficiently distribute water to your plants. Consider using drip irrigation, soaker hoses, or even a simple DIY network of tubes and nozzles.
With some planning and effort, you can create a micro homestead watering system that is both sustainable and effective.
